When I was 23 and a full time student I went into my Lloyds branch and asked about a guarantor mortgage - my dad was going to be the guarantor. The person I spoke to suggested I try for my own mortgage as I was working part time as well. I hadnt thought this was an option, but this was back in the day when they gave mortgages away freely!

An application for a 95% interest only mortgage was approved in principle that day! I was stunned and excited. Next problem - How to get the 5%. The advisor suggested a loan from Lloyds and an appointment was set up for me that week.

I met with the bank worker about the loan. I can't remember much of the conversation other than he was being very matey and was very confident it would be approved.

The loan was approved for £4k, and afterwards he actually suggested I try again for another few grand. luckily I declined.
Looking back I cant believe how easy they made it to access huge amounts of money - we'll never see those days again! (thankfully)

So anyway, the loan is now paid off as of 2008. I wondered the steps I would take to find out if I was paying PPI. I don't have the paperwork any more but I do have a record of the loan account or reference number on my bank statements.

Can anyone point me in the right direction / to an appropriate thread / template letter?

    I just rang Lloyds loan dept and a very helpful lady told me which past loans we had ppi on some as far back as 2002/2003. She then put me through to ppi claims dept to make a claim. Hope this helps.
